I got my NOS purge, (install instructions from Matt@HSW)
I see many people making it vent by the windshield etc......how the heck do you do that with this lil hard line that came with the kit?

Im assuming that you were supplied with a 6in line then.. You will need about 3ft to make it out the hood correctly.. You can buy some 3/16 ss tubing typically used for brake lines, you need to flare 1 end and just put a #3b-nut/sleeve on it to acheive the same goal.. Thanks David@TNT

Use 3/16" hard brake line. It is cheap, bends easy, comes in different lengths from 1 foot to 5 feet, and is availible from any auto parts store.
